IT Support Pricing for Dundas Businesses
Fusion provides IT support under a fixed monthly contract. Pricing varies by user count, number of locations, and security requirements. For Dundas businesses, pricing typically falls in the $180 to $250 per user per month range, which covers help desk, monitoring, patching, cybersecurity, and Microsoft 365 administration.

IT Support in Dundas: Local Business Context
Dundas is Hamilton’s smallest former municipality. A heritage commercial village along King Street West with roughly 25,000 residents and a mix of healthcare practitioners, professional services, and small manufacturers along the Sydenham Road corridor. The town-within-a-city geography means many businesses are single-location firms where the owner is effectively the IT department. When something fails before a client presentation or a patient appointment, there’s no internal team to call.
PIPEDA applies to all Ontario private-sector businesses, and Dundas’s healthcare cluster adds Ontario PHIPA obligations. Healthcare practitioners. Family physicians, physiotherapists, occupational therapists. Operate under PHIPA with mandatory breach notification and specific requirements for electronic health record security. The valley geography around Spencer Creek includes light manufacturing and environmental engineering firms that hold sensitive technical data and client project files.
The 403/Hwy 8 connection to Hamilton and Burlington means Dundas businesses regularly serve clients beyond the immediate area. Remote access requirements for staff working from client sites or from home are a consistent infrastructure challenge for small firms. Fusion’s IT support covers secure VPN setup, remote endpoint monitoring, and Microsoft 365 administration so your team connects reliably whether they’re in the Dundas Village office or at a Hamilton client site.

Does Fusion support Dundas healthcare practitioners under PHIPA?
Yes. Family physicians, physiotherapists, and allied health practitioners in Dundas are subject to Ontario’s PHIPA. Fusion’s IT support includes the controls PHIPA requires: encrypted patient data in transit and at rest, access logging, documented incident response, and backup procedures aligned to health record retention requirements. For practitioners using OntarioMD-certified EMR systems, Fusion coordinates technical compatibility with certification requirements.
